Free Download GSview – A graphical interface for Ghostscript. able to load and edit files in Portable Document Format, PS and EPS as well. EPS files cannot contain a media size request. In the absence of any media size request Ghostscript uses the default.

PostScript type for this CID font. Suppress messages -q Quiet startup: Profiles to demonstrate this method of specification are also included in this folder. There are several debugging switches that are detected by the interpreter. There is, therefore, a chance that glyphs may be wrong, or missing in the output when this fallback is used.

General switches Input control filename Causes Ghostscript to read filename and treat its contents the same as the command line. This must be an absolute path. Each argument must be valid PostScript, either individual tokens as defined by the token operator, or a string containing valid PostScript.

GSview Help

For example, A3 is -sx Default values for these arguments are equal to argument names. Special instructions to be inserted into C code for generating the output. There is also a handy refresh command called ‘Redisplay’ that will reload the current view so you can check out any changes that may have occurred since first opening the document. Also, since some devices write output files when opened, there may be an extra blank page written pdfwrite, ps2write, eps2write, pxlmono, pxlcolor, Invoking Ghostscript This document describes how to use the command line Ghostscript client.

Debugging The information here describing is probably interesting only to developers. Third-party font renderers may be incompatible with devices that can embed fonts in their output such as pdfwritebecause such renderers may store fonts in a form from which Ghostscript cannot get the necessary information for epa, for example, the Microtype fonts supplied with the UFST. The interpreter also quits gracefully if it encounters end-of-file or control-C. There is no particular reason to use these instead of the corresponding fonts in the Ghostscript distribution which are of just as good qualityexcept to save about a gxview of disk space, but the installation documentation explains how to do it on Unix.


On some systems, Ghostscript may read the input one character at a time, which is useful for programs such as ghostview that generate input for Ghostscript dynamically and watch for some response, but can slow processing.

Some printers can print at several different resolutions, letting you balance resolution against printing speed. Provide a True Type font with Unicode Encoding. When Ghostscript finishes executing the file, it exits back to the shell. It controls grid fitting gsviea True Type fonts Sometimes referred to as “hinting”, but strictly speaking the latter is a feature of Type 1 fonts.

Because of bugs in the SCO Unix kernel, Ghostscript will not work if you select direct screen output and also allow it to write messages on the console. The format is similar to FAPIfontmapbut gsvies must contain few different entries:.

If UFST needs it and the command line argument is not specified, Ghostscript prints a warning and searches symbol set files ysview the current directory. You can switch devices at any time by using the selectdevice procedure, for instance like one of these:. A directory listed in the section How Ghostscript finds filesexcept the current directory; The value of the system parameter GenericResourceDir ; The name of the resource category for instance, CMap epd The name of the resource instance for instance, Identity-H Due to possible variety of the part 1, the first successful combination is used.

For this situation, you can supply Ghostscript with the command line option: Working around bugs in X servers The ” use Devices may, or may not, have support for spot colors.

If -zdevice is not used, the Ghostscript device bmpmono or pbmraw will be used to create the bitmap. This prevents allocation of excessively large amounts of memory for the transparency buffer stack. This may appear as white or black rectangles where characters should appear; or characters may appear in “inverse video” for instance, white on a black rectangle rather gsviwe black on white.

Overprinting is not allowed gsvifw devices with an additive process gsciew model. It is possible to specify a particular output intent where int is an integer a value of 0 is the same as not specifying a number.


How to Use Ghostscript

The effects of overprinting should not be confused with the PDF 1. This switch is primarily useful for PDF creation using the pdfwrite device when retaining the color spaces from the original document is important. In this case, spot colors will pass through unprocessed assuming the device supports those colorants.

Command line options Unless otherwise noted, these switches can be used on all platforms. How to fix EPS with incorrect bounding box? There are other utility scripts besides ps2pdfincluding pdf2psps2epsipdf2dscps2asciips2ps and ps2ps2.

The Licence grants you the right to copy, modify and redistribute GSview, but only under certain conditions described in the Licence. If the OutputConditionIdentifier is not a standard identifier then it should be Custom and the UseOutputIntent string will be matched against the value of the Info key instead.

Only 1 and 42 are currently allowed. In the table below, the first column is a debugging switch, the second is an equivalent switch if any and the third is its usage. By using our site, you acknowledge that you have read and understand our Cookie PolicyPrivacy Policyand our Terms of Service. There are two ways to select other paper sizes from the command line:.

The format specifier is of a form similar to the C printf format. While the ICC does define a named color format, this structure can in practice be much more general. With this interface it is possible to provide this definition.

If this happens, try setting useXPutImage to false.

Only 0, 1 and 2 are currently allowed. Takes the next argument as a file name as usual, but takes all remaining arguments even if they have the syntactic form of switches and defines the name ARGUMENTS in userdict not systemdict as an array of those strings, before running the file.

In all but special cases image interpolation uses a Mitchell filter function to scale the contributions for each output pixel.

It is used this way in the examples at the beginning of this document.